July 2019 Visa Bulletin Update

The Department of State has posted the visa bulletin for July 2019.

EB-1 Priority Workers final action date is now April 22, 2018 for all nationals, except those born in India with a cutoff date of January 1, 2015 and China with a cutoff date of May 8, 2017.

EB-2 and EB-3 is current (no backlog) for all nationals, except those born in India who have a cutoff date of April 24, 2009 (EB-2) and July 1, 2009 (EB-3) AND those born in China who now have a cutoff date of November 1, 2016 (EB-2) and January 1 (EB-3).

The USCIS announced that it will accept adjustment of status applications in July for family-based petitions for those with priority dates before the listed cutoff date in the filing dates chart. For employment- based petitioners, the USCIS will accept adjustment of status applications in April for those with priority dates before the listed cutoff date in the final action chart.

However, for both family and employment based petitions, your priority date must be earlier than the date in the final action chart for final approval of your immigrant visa or adjustment of status application.
